1. Set Clear Objectives

The foundation of improving productivity begins with setting defined objectives. When goals are well outlined, it gives a path to pursue, making activities more manageable. Consider prioritizing your projects based on significance and urgency.

2. Incorporate Technology

Modern-day technology provides a plethora of tools that can greatly boost productivity. From project management software to automating mundane tasks, technology acts as an indispensable partner in effective work management.

3. Adapt to Flexible Schedules

In recent years, the conventional 9-to-5 routine is turning obsolete. Allowing flexible schedules can significantly boost productivity by providing individuals the leeway to work during their optimal hours of focus.

5. Consistent Breaks and Health Practices

Productivity isn't about working long hours without pause. Embedding consistent breaks can rejuvenate the mind. Practices like meditation or light exercise can additionally enhance focus and reduce stress.
